Output 6cc248857ce64d4e8ea55f85ac2ce24dea0dc1e2a06e7495902110dbeaab8819:0

value
39371
script pubkey
OP_0 OP_PUSHBYTES_20 0990c644952d90551fddf7bb3dde570b607f4e5d
address
bc1qpxgvv3y49kg9287a77anmhjhpds87njax2jl0d
transaction
6cc248857ce64d4e8ea55f85ac2ce24dea0dc1e2a06e7495902110dbeaab8819
confirmations
106757
spent
true